This document summarizes tips for succeeding on computer-based tests (CBTs). It outlines steps like setting goals for each subject, choosing courses of interest to study, using brochures to select accurate subject combinations, treating English as a core subject, preparing with the syllabus, taking mock exams, and familiarizing with the computer testing process. On exam day, candidates should login by entering their registration number, start each subject individually within the time limit, select answers using the mouse or keyboard, review answers before submitting, and end the exam by confirming submission.
